Death Stranding 2 info from Hideotube:

• State of Play trailer was captured on PS5. Kojima thinks the graphics will improve even more.

• Production timeline: "The assets are ready we just need to construct them." Japanese audio dubbing will begin this year for release in 2025.

• Sam can now remove his backpack for lighter movement and combat.

• Realtime terrain deformation is in the game. Roads can be cut off via earthquakes, forest fires, floods, etc.

• Ship is called the Magellan. It serves as a moving base that accompanies Sam on deliveries. It can also go underground.

• When Sam connects to the Chiral Network, the ship can move freely to those areas. You can also call it to you.

• Game is on a different continent outside of America, where Sam has gone to connect the Chiral Network.

• Fragile starts a new group called Drawbridge to connect regions outside the UCA. She is their leader and "no longer her weak self from the past."

• A private entity has to go setup the network because If the UCA goes it can be regarded as an invasion.

• The 'Second Hand' that Fragile has will be a big part of the game

• The model for the puppet is Faith Akin, a German director. You'll travel with him by your side and can converse with him on deliveries.

• "Why he became that way, you'll learn as you play the game."

• The cat on George Miller's shoulder is inspired by Captain Harlock

• "Lots of vehicles"

• Elle Fanning's character is 'mysterious', could be friend or foe.
